Abstract

The invention relates to the technical field of gas control, in particular to a preparation method of a gas elimination agent and application thereof. The preparation method of the gas elimination agent comprises the following steps that bean seedling is sealed and fermented, fermentation gas I and fermentation liquid I are obtained; water and the fermentation gas I are added to the surface of a refuse landfill; fermentation liquid II is collected after fermentation; the fermentation liquid I and crop straw are added into the fermentation liquid II; fermentation liquid III is collected; and the gas elimination agent is obtained after dilution. Ten days after the gas elimination agent is injected into a mine, gas is reduced by 54.42%, after eleven days, the gas content is reduced by 79.59%,and after twenty-two days, the gas is reduced by 82.39%. Compared with an existing method of eliminating methane by a chemical method, secondary pollution is avoided, the method is safe and mild, crop waste is adopted, and the problem that the crop waste is hard to process is solved. The gas is cleared more completely, and production efficiency is increased multiply.

Description

technical field [0001] The invention relates to the field of gas control, in particular to a preparation method and application of a gas eliminating agent. Background technique [0002] Gas management is a worldwide problem, and there is no fundamental solution to gas disasters. Therefore, in order to reduce the occurrence of accidents, many developed countries prohibit the mining of mines with a large amount of gas emission, and only mine mines with a small amount of gas emission. my country is a developing country, and energy is very scarce. Coal accounts for more than 70% of my country's total energy consumption, and coal production directly affects the development of the national economy (Zhu Wangxi et al., 2004). This has led to actively creating conditions for mining wherever there are coal reserves in our country, no matter whether it is a low-gas or high-gas mining area.
